Pay in context

Top pay as a share of expenses

In 2024, the highest total compensation at PIERCE CHARITABLE TRUST XXX-XX-XXXX equaled 23% of the organization's total expenses. The median for philanthropy, voluntarism & grantmaking organizations is 15%.

This organization (2024)
23%
Sector median
15%
Middle half of sector
5% to 24%

Based on 35,946 philanthropy, voluntarism & grantmaking organizations, each measured at its most recent filing year with reported expenses and compensation.
